Oracle中序列的用法

創建sequence

create sequence hero_seq

increment by 1

start with 1

maxvalue 9999999

解釋:hero_seq:一般是表明_seq

使用sequence

select hero_seq.nextval from dual


獲取hero_seq的下一個值

select hero_seq.currval from dual


獲取hero_seq的當前值

作爲id插入到表中

insert into hero (id,name,hp,mp,damage,armor,speed) values(hero_seq.nextval,'炸彈人',450,200,45,3,300);

 

 

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章